Is it possible to hide extension resources in the Chrome web inspector network tab?
...requests from extensions, as mentioned by a commenter on the issue I originally opened.
In the network tab filter box, enter the string -scheme:chrome-extension (as shown below):
This is case-sensitive, so make sure it's lowercase. Doing this will hide all resources which were requested by exten...

Count occurrences of a char in plain text file
...
If all you need to do is count the number of lines containing your character, this will work:
grep -c 'f' myfile
However, it counts multiple occurrences of 'f' on the same line as a single match.
